Jakarta, CNBC Indonesia - Finance Minister Purbaya Yudhi Sadewa has acknowledged that the briefing in preparation for departure for LPDP scholarship recipients by the Indonesian National Armed Forces (TNI) will increase the budget expenditure.

However, he explained that this additional budget would serve as an investment for the nation to cultivate a love for the homeland among the scholarship recipients.

“It’s an investment. If it adds a little, it’s not much compared to the cost of them studying abroad for years. And if they don’t return, the loss is significant for me. It’s better to add a small investment,” Purbaya stated to reporters, as quoted on Tuesday (5/5/2026).

Purbaya also stressed that the additional budget for the TNI briefing for LPDP participants is not substantial. According to him, the amount is relatively small.

“It’s with the military, with the TNI, so the cost isn’t the commercial private sector price, right. The cost is sufficient, but not excessive,” he said.

The former LPS chief refuted claims that the TNI’s involvement in the Departure Preparation (PK) activities for LPDP scholarship recipients has military objectives. According to him, the TNI briefing is intended to strengthen the discipline and nationalism of the LPDP scholarship recipients. Physical exercises such as push-ups and sit-ups are part of building discipline.

“LPDP has further briefing from the TNI, not for war but to train and strengthen their sense of nationalism. Usually, sit-ups and push-ups are about discipline, which is actually training in love for the country. Discipline is love for the nation,” said Purbaya.
